自助棋牌室小程序如何提升网络性能
发布时间:2025-01-08
提升自助棋牌室小程序的网络性能可以从以下几个方面入手:
1. 优化网络请求减少网络请求次数可以显著提升网络性能。可以通过合并多个请求为一个请求,减少服务器响应时间和网络传输时间。此外,使用合适的数据格式(如JSON、Protocol Buffers等)可以减少数据传输量和解析时间。
2. 使用缓存合理使用缓存可以减少重复的网络请求。在小程序中,可以使用和来实现数据的缓存。例如,对于一些静态数据或者频繁使用的数据,可以将其缓存到本地,减少对服务器的请求。
3. 优化页面渲染避免过多的节点层级和频繁的重绘和重排,可以提高页面的响应速度和流畅度。在展示大量数据列表时,使用虚拟列表可以减少渲染的节点数量,提高页面的渲染性能。
4. 优化代码执行避免频繁的数据绑定和过多的页面跳转,可以提高小程序的响应速度和流畅度。合理使用异步操作(如Promise、async/await等)来处理耗时的任务,避免阻塞主线程。
5. 图片优化压缩图片大小和使用合适的图片格式(如WebP)可以减少图片的加载时间。此外,对于非关键性的图片内容,可以采用懒加载的方式,只有当用户需要查看时才进行加载,以减少初始加载量。
6. 使用CDN加速内容分发网络(CDN)可以将静态资源分发到全球各地的服务器,从而提供更快的访问速度。在小程序中,可以将一些常用的静态资源(如图片、样式文件等)通过CDN进行加速,从而减少加载时间。
7. 性能监控和测试使用性能监控工具(如微信开发者工具提供的性能监控工具)可以帮助开发者监测小程序的性能指标,如渲染时间、网络请求时间等,及时发现性能瓶颈。进行性能测试,评估小程序在不同设备和网络环境下的性能表现,找出潜在的性能问题并进行优化。
通过上述方法,可以有效地提升自助棋牌室小程序的网络性能,提供更好的用户体验。
展开全文
其他新闻
- 自助棋牌室小程序的网络通信是如何实现的 2025-01-08
- 自助棋牌室小程序开发如何与第三方系统对接 2025-01-08
- 自助棋牌室小程序开发如何进行资源管理 2025-01-08
- 自助棋牌室小程序开发如何保证稳定性 2025-01-08
- 商城小程序开发者怎样实现小程序的用户需求挖掘 2025-01-08
- 商城小程序开发者怎样实现小程序的用户忠诚度提升 2025-01-08
- 商城小程序开发者如何进行商品的分类筛选优化 2025-01-08
- 商城小程序开发者怎样实现小程序的屏幕适配 2025-01-08
- 商城小程序开发者如何进行商品的供应商管理 2025-01-08
- 商城小程序开发者如何进行用户的消费金额分析 2025-01-08